Escape the everyday and dive into a memorable family vacation in sunny San Pedro, Belize. With its vibrant atmosphere and pristine beaches, this Caribbean paradise offers something for everyone. Craft lasting memories as you explore the coral reefs teeming with marine life, unwind the sun on pristine shores, and experience the delicious local cuisi